Did you know that optimizing your Magento store can significantly enhance your sales and user experience? At Fresh Social Wave, we recognize the importance of effective Magento development practices for an online store’s success. In this blog post, we’ll cover the top 10 best practices for Magento development that every store owner should follow. Whether you’re a beginner or looking to fine-tune your skills, there’s valuable information here for everyone.
Top 10 Best Practices for Magento Development
Implementing the right practices in your Magento development can set your store apart in the competitive eCommerce space. Here, we’ll explore each of these practices in detail to help you create a robust online presence.
Understanding Magento Best Practices
Magento is a powerful eCommerce platform, but how you use it greatly affects your store’s performance. Understanding and implementing best practices can lead to improved functionality and user satisfaction.
Using best practices guarantees that your online store runs fault-free and offers first-rate consumer experience. These methods address security, performance, and user experience among other facets. For instance, consistent upgrades to your Magento system not only increase security but also bring fresh features and improvements meant to increase sales.
Following best practices has really important advantages. Stores that apply these rules usually enjoy a notable rise in general income, user interaction, and conversion rates. Recent research indicates that companies which maximize their eCommerce website can boost sales by up to 50%.
In conclusion, adopting Magento best practices can transform your store from average to exceptional.
Best Practice
Description
Regular Updates
Keep your Magento system updated for the latest features and security patches.
Security Measures
Implement strong passwords and two-factor authentication to protect user data.
Performance Optimization
Use caching and image compression techniques to enhance loading speeds.
How to Set Up a Magento Store Successfully
Setting up a Magento store correctly from the start is crucial for long-term success. A step-by-step approach to setup can help avoid common pitfalls.
Start with selecting the appropriate hosting company. Critical elements for client satisfaction are speed and dependability of your store, which directly depend on the performance of your server. Among the recommendations are Magento hosting-oriented providers, who frequently provide solutions for best performance.
Installing Magento comes next once hosting is under control. For best security and functionality, be sure you are running the most recent edition. Online guides abound that provide a whole tour of the installation process.
Customizing the look and use of your store is crucial following installation. Use the built-in design tools in Magento and give thought to using popular extensions to enhance features. Document all modifications for your records going forward.
Common setup pitfalls include neglecting security measures and failing to optimize for mobile devices. Addressing these aspects early can save you significant time and effort down the line.
Customization is key to making your Magento store unique and aligned with your brand. However, it’s essential to approach customization wisely.
Understanding the Need for Customization
Customizing your Magento store allows you to tailor the user experience to your audience’s needs. Knowing when to customize and what areas to focus on is crucial.
Common areas for customization include the theme, functionality, and user experience features. Each customization should aim to improve usability and meet specific business goals. For example, if analytics shows users dropping off during checkout, consider simplifying the process or introducing a guest checkout feature.
Balancing customization with performance is important. Heavy customization can lead to slower load times, which can deter potential customers. Aim for a streamlined design that still reflects your brand’s identity.
There are numerous tools available for customizing Magento effectively. Utilizing these tools can help you get the most out of your store.
Popular tools include Magento’s built-in theme editor and third-party extensions. These tools allow for easy adjustments to your store without needing extensive coding knowledge. Some extensions can automate tasks or enhance your product management capabilities.
Creating custom themes requires adhering to Magento’s coding standards. This ensures compatibility with future updates and reduces maintenance issues down the line.
Troubleshooting Common Magento Issues
Every store owner will face challenges, but knowing how to troubleshoot common Magento issues can save time and prevent frustration.
Identifying Common Challenges
Common Magento errors include slow performance, checkout issues, and security vulnerabilities. Understanding these challenges is the first step in resolving them.
Performance issues can often arise from poor hosting or excessive customization. Regularly monitor your site’s performance metrics to catch these issues early.
Security vulnerabilities are another concern. Ensure your store is updated regularly and consider implementing additional security measures, such as two-factor authentication.
Finding help is crucial when you encounter problems. There are numerous resources available for troubleshooting Magento stores.
Online communities, forums, and official documentation can provide invaluable support. Engaging with the community can also lead to discovering practices others have learned through experience.
Magento’s built-in tools can assist in diagnosing issues as well. Familiarize yourself with these tools and consider utilizing them regularly for maintenance.
For a more hands-on approach, consider hiring a Magento consultant to help resolve complex issues.
Enhancing Magento Performance
Performance is a significant aspect of any online store. Regularly optimizing your Magento store can lead to better user experiences and increased sales.
Optimizing Store Speed
Speed is key for user retention and conversion. There are several strategies to improve the speed of your Magento store.
Implementing caching solutions can drastically improve load times. Magento offers built-in caching features that can be enabled in the settings. Using a Content Delivery Network (CDN) can also help deliver content faster.
Another effective way to optimize speed is through image compression. Large images can significantly slow down your site, so ensuring they are properly sized and compressed is vital.
Caching is one of the most effective tools for improving Magento performance. Understanding the types of caching available is important.
Magento provides several caching options, including block caching, full-page caching, and session caching. Each serves a unique purpose and can drastically speed up your store.
Implementing these caching options requires configuring your Magento settings. Regularly clear your cache to maintain optimal performance.
What are the best practices for Magento development?
Best practices for Magento development include regular updates, choosing a reliable hosting provider, optimizing store speed, and implementing security measures to protect data.
How do I set up a Magento store?
Setting up a Magento store involves selecting a hosting provider, installing Magento, customizing your theme, and configuring payment and shipping options based on your business needs.
What are common Magento issues?
Common issues include slow performance, checkout problems, and security vulnerabilities. Regular maintenance and updates can help mitigate these problems.
How can I improve the performance of my Magento store?
Improving performance can include optimizing images, implementing caching, and using a Content Delivery Network (CDN) to speed up content delivery.
How do I troubleshoot Magento problems?
Troubleshooting involves identifying the issue first, checking server performance, and consulting community resources or hiring experts for complex problems.
Conclusion
In summary, following these Magento best practices can lead to a more efficient, secure, and user-friendly online store. By understanding the importance of setup, customization, and troubleshooting, you can position your store for success. We invite you to share your thoughts and experiences with Magento development in the comments below. For more insightful articles, visit Fresh Social Wave.
Top 10 Best Practices for Magento Development
Did you know that optimizing your Magento store can significantly enhance your sales and user experience? At Fresh Social Wave, we recognize the importance of effective Magento development practices for an online store’s success. In this blog post, we’ll cover the top 10 best practices for Magento development that every store owner should follow. Whether you’re a beginner or looking to fine-tune your skills, there’s valuable information here for everyone.
Top 10 Best Practices for Magento Development
Implementing the right practices in your Magento development can set your store apart in the competitive eCommerce space. Here, we’ll explore each of these practices in detail to help you create a robust online presence.
Understanding Magento Best Practices
Magento is a powerful eCommerce platform, but how you use it greatly affects your store’s performance. Understanding and implementing best practices can lead to improved functionality and user satisfaction.
Using best practices guarantees that your online store runs fault-free and offers first-rate consumer experience. These methods address security, performance, and user experience among other facets. For instance, consistent upgrades to your Magento system not only increase security but also bring fresh features and improvements meant to increase sales.
Following best practices has really important advantages. Stores that apply these rules usually enjoy a notable rise in general income, user interaction, and conversion rates. Recent research indicates that companies which maximize their eCommerce website can boost sales by up to 50%.
In conclusion, adopting Magento best practices can transform your store from average to exceptional.
How to Set Up a Magento Store Successfully
Setting up a Magento store correctly from the start is crucial for long-term success. A step-by-step approach to setup can help avoid common pitfalls.
Start with selecting the appropriate hosting company. Critical elements for client satisfaction are speed and dependability of your store, which directly depend on the performance of your server. Among the recommendations are Magento hosting-oriented providers, who frequently provide solutions for best performance.
Installing Magento comes next once hosting is under control. For best security and functionality, be sure you are running the most recent edition. Online guides abound that provide a whole tour of the installation process.
Customizing the look and use of your store is crucial following installation. Use the built-in design tools in Magento and give thought to using popular extensions to enhance features. Document all modifications for your records going forward.
Common setup pitfalls include neglecting security measures and failing to optimize for mobile devices. Addressing these aspects early can save you significant time and effort down the line.
For a more detailed guide on the setup process, check out our post on Essential Tips to Improve Mobile Page Speed.
Magento Customization Best Practices
Customization is key to making your Magento store unique and aligned with your brand. However, it’s essential to approach customization wisely.
Understanding the Need for Customization
Customizing your Magento store allows you to tailor the user experience to your audience’s needs. Knowing when to customize and what areas to focus on is crucial.
Common areas for customization include the theme, functionality, and user experience features. Each customization should aim to improve usability and meet specific business goals. For example, if analytics shows users dropping off during checkout, consider simplifying the process or introducing a guest checkout feature.
Balancing customization with performance is important. Heavy customization can lead to slower load times, which can deter potential customers. Aim for a streamlined design that still reflects your brand’s identity.
To learn how to implement these changes, refer to our in-depth article on Top 10 Best Tools for Android Development.
Magento Customization Tools and Techniques
There are numerous tools available for customizing Magento effectively. Utilizing these tools can help you get the most out of your store.
Popular tools include Magento’s built-in theme editor and third-party extensions. These tools allow for easy adjustments to your store without needing extensive coding knowledge. Some extensions can automate tasks or enhance your product management capabilities.
Creating custom themes requires adhering to Magento’s coding standards. This ensures compatibility with future updates and reduces maintenance issues down the line.
Troubleshooting Common Magento Issues
Every store owner will face challenges, but knowing how to troubleshoot common Magento issues can save time and prevent frustration.
Identifying Common Challenges
Common Magento errors include slow performance, checkout issues, and security vulnerabilities. Understanding these challenges is the first step in resolving them.
Performance issues can often arise from poor hosting or excessive customization. Regularly monitor your site’s performance metrics to catch these issues early.
Security vulnerabilities are another concern. Ensure your store is updated regularly and consider implementing additional security measures, such as two-factor authentication.
For detailed solutions to these challenges, refer to our guide on How to Fix Android TV Freezing Issues.
Resources for Troubleshooting
Finding help is crucial when you encounter problems. There are numerous resources available for troubleshooting Magento stores.
Online communities, forums, and official documentation can provide invaluable support. Engaging with the community can also lead to discovering practices others have learned through experience.
Magento’s built-in tools can assist in diagnosing issues as well. Familiarize yourself with these tools and consider utilizing them regularly for maintenance.
For a more hands-on approach, consider hiring a Magento consultant to help resolve complex issues.
Enhancing Magento Performance
Performance is a significant aspect of any online store. Regularly optimizing your Magento store can lead to better user experiences and increased sales.
Optimizing Store Speed
Speed is key for user retention and conversion. There are several strategies to improve the speed of your Magento store.
Implementing caching solutions can drastically improve load times. Magento offers built-in caching features that can be enabled in the settings. Using a Content Delivery Network (CDN) can also help deliver content faster.
Another effective way to optimize speed is through image compression. Large images can significantly slow down your site, so ensuring they are properly sized and compressed is vital.
For further insights on this subject, check our article on Best Photo Editing Apps for Instagram in 2023.
Using Caching Effectively
Caching is one of the most effective tools for improving Magento performance. Understanding the types of caching available is important.
Magento provides several caching options, including block caching, full-page caching, and session caching. Each serves a unique purpose and can drastically speed up your store.
Implementing these caching options requires configuring your Magento settings. Regularly clear your cache to maintain optimal performance.
For additional resources, refer to our post on How to Create and Manage Content Types in Drupal.
Frequently Asked Questions
What are the best practices for Magento development?
Best practices for Magento development include regular updates, choosing a reliable hosting provider, optimizing store speed, and implementing security measures to protect data.
How do I set up a Magento store?
Setting up a Magento store involves selecting a hosting provider, installing Magento, customizing your theme, and configuring payment and shipping options based on your business needs.
What are common Magento issues?
Common issues include slow performance, checkout problems, and security vulnerabilities. Regular maintenance and updates can help mitigate these problems.
How can I improve the performance of my Magento store?
Improving performance can include optimizing images, implementing caching, and using a Content Delivery Network (CDN) to speed up content delivery.
How do I troubleshoot Magento problems?
Troubleshooting involves identifying the issue first, checking server performance, and consulting community resources or hiring experts for complex problems.
Conclusion
In summary, following these Magento best practices can lead to a more efficient, secure, and user-friendly online store. By understanding the importance of setup, customization, and troubleshooting, you can position your store for success. We invite you to share your thoughts and experiences with Magento development in the comments below. For more insightful articles, visit Fresh Social Wave.
Archives
Categories
Recent Posts
Ultimate Guide to Responsive Web Design Techniques
November 13, 2024Best Responsive Joomla Themes for Every Site
November 13, 2024Guide to Customizing Joomla Templates
November 13, 2024Calendar